Overview
The Los Angeles Lakers are a storied NBA franchise based in Los Angeles, California. Founded in 1947 as the Minneapolis Lakers, the team moved to Los Angeles in 1960 and has since become synonymous with championship success, featuring legends such as Magic Johnson, Kareem Abdul‑Jabbar, Shaquille O'Neal and Kobe Bryant. The Lakers have captured 17 NBA titles, the most recent coming in the 2020 bubble season, and are known for their "Showtime" brand of fast‑paced, high‑scoring basketball.
